Output 942660191490deb31a51390e32863a796e1fcb66c28a263bce21ebc5ca01254b:0

value
2000000
script pubkey
OP_0 OP_PUSHBYTES_20 d6b39c517fc722529fdd687e80505e99db5710ed
address
ltc1q66eec5tlcu39987adplgq5z7n8d4wy8djh34x9
transaction
942660191490deb31a51390e32863a796e1fcb66c28a263bce21ebc5ca01254b
spent
true